post-promotion-placement#checkSidebarAdDisplayCondition" data-controller="scroll-position sticky-ad post-promotion-placement ">
scroll-to-target-tracking#onClick" data-label="Scroll to top" data-target-selector="#page-body"> Scroll to đứng top
*
Karen Pogosyan Dec 7, năm nhâm thìn
Read Time: 11 min url-selector#selectionChanged"> Deutsch English Español हिंदी Hrvatski Bahasa Indonesia Pусский Wikang Tagalog українська мова tiếng Việt

Visual Composer là plugin WordPress chất nhận được các trang được xây dựng bằng cách sử dụng một giao diện kéo-thả. Nó cung cấp cho những người dùng khả năng bố trí trang web một giải pháp dễ dàng, với nó đem về cho các nhà phát triển cơ hội để thêm vào những giá trị cho theme WordPress của họ. Trong chỉ dẫn này chúng ta sẽ coi xét các vấn đề pháp lý và chuyên môn của việc tích hợp Visual Composer vào các theme nhằm bán.

Bạn đang xem: Visual composer là gì? cài đặt và sử dụng visual composer

Visual Composer kèm theo với:

Trình biên soạn thảo phối kết hợp front-end cùng back-end cho WordPress trên 40 phần tử nội dung sẵn bao gồm và hơn 200 add-ons (phần phụ trợ), có phong cách thiết kế để nâng trang web của doanh nghiệp lên một tầm cao mới. Thư viện template được cho phép người cần sử dụng WordPress tầm nã xuất hàng nghìn bố cục chất lượng cao. Trình xây dựng bối cảnh (Skin builder) mang đến phép chuyển đổi nhanh chóng hình ảnh trực quan tiền của theme. Grid builder (Trình xây dựng bố cục ô lưới) nâng cấp cho những tập tin nhiều phương tiện, bài xích viết, portfolio và những kiểu nội dung bài viết tuỳ vươn lên là (custom post type).

Vậy đó là các tính năng chủ yếu của Visual Composer, tất cả được tổng hợp, bao hàm gói cung cấp trị giá bán 34$ (giấy phép thường tại thời khắc Tháng mười nhì 2016).

Visual Composer cho các nhà trở nên tân tiến theme

Hãy nghĩ một chút ít về vì sao các nhà trở nên tân tiến theme buộc phải tích thích hợp hoặc không ngừng mở rộng Visual Composer, và các tác cồn của bản thảo lên những bài toán làm đó.

Bán theme WordPress rất có thể là một nghề tạo nên lợi nhuận cao, cho dù bạn hiện tại đang bán riêng hoặc thông qua thị trường mua phân phối như ga-analytics#sendMarketClickEvent">ThemeForest. Là người sáng tác (ga-analytics#sendMarketClickEvent">Ninzio Themes) cửa hàng chúng tôi hiểu được phần thưởng, dẫu vậy hiểu được việc cải tiến và phát triển theme hoàn toàn có thể khó như vậy nào, và đông đảo gì từng nhà trở nên tân tiến muốn đạt được từ sản phẩm của họ. 

Giảm thời hạn và chi tiêu phát triển. Một sản phẩm chất lượng cao. Tăng buổi tối đa lệch giá Giảm thời gian cung ứng Tập trung vào các tính năng mới và tiếp thị

Và bạn biết sao không? Visual Composer hoàn toàn có thể giúp bạn đã có được những phương châm đó trực tiếp và gián tiếp. Hãy nhằm tôi giải thích cho bạn:

Nhiều theme WordPress tích phù hợp sẵn một Page Builder (Trình chế tạo trang), và việc xây dựng chúng biến đổi một xu hướng giữa những năm qua, nhưng lại ngày nay, những đối thủ tuyên chiến đối đầu đang ngày một nhiều hơn, thiệt sự không kết quả về ngân sách chi tiêu và thời gian để cải cách và phát triển một chiến thuật tuỳ thay đổi cho theme của bạn. Rứa vào đó, Visual Composer rất có thể được tích hợp vào vào theme của bạn, và cung cấp miễn phí tổn cho khách hàng của khách hàng (miễn phí tổn để thực hiện với theme của bạn thôi nhé).

Nếu bạn tìm tìm ga-analytics#sendMarketClickEvent">các theme WordPress hàng đầu trên ThemeForest các bạn sẽ nhận thấy rằng số đông mọi theme đã bao gồm tích đúng theo sẵn Visual Composer bên trong nó; ngay cả những theme mà bạn dạng thân nó tất cả sẵn một page builder. Visual Composer là 1 trong sản phẩm được rất nhiều người biết đến, được kiểm thử hàng ngàn lần bởi vì hàng triệu người dùng và những nhà phát triển.

*
*
*
ga-analytics#sendMarketClickEvent">Các theme WordPress số 1 trên ThemeForest

Tại thời khắc này chúng ta đã hiểu rõ tại sao Visual Composer đang trở thành (gần như) yếu hèn tố cần thiết cho những nhà phát triển theme WordPress thành công, và vì sao tại sao bạn nên suy xét tích vừa lòng nó vào trong theme của bạn.

Câu hỏi tiếp theo là: làm cố gắng nào họ tích thích hợp Visual Composer, và chúng ta có quyền làm điều đó không?

Tích phù hợp vào theme: gợi ý Pháp lý

Nếu bạn là 1 trong nhà phát triển theme đã nghĩ đến sự việc tích đúng theo Visual Composer vào trong theme của bạn, thì đó là một tóm tắt ngắn về những vấn đề cần thiết:

"Vào ngày 22 tháng một năm 2013 Envato đã update giấy phép của họ và nó ko còn chất nhận được sử dụng các thành phầm từ thị trường bên trong sản phẩm của chúng ta mà ý định được được phân phối trên Envato nếu không có một sự đồng ý giữa nhì tác giả. Trong trường hòa hợp này thân tôi (Michael M) và bạn (tác giả theme)." - Michael M

Vì vậy,... Nếu bạn có nhu cầu bao tất cả Visual Composer vào theme của bạn, chúng ta phải giữ hộ thư cho Michael? như ý là bạn không cần. Quy trình này đã được tự động. Hãy search hiểu, từng bước một một, cách chúng ta có thể có giấy phép hợp lệ của Visual Composer.

Mua giấy phép không ngừng mở rộng (Extended License)

Đầu tiên bạn sẽ cần mua giấy phép không ngừng mở rộng của Visual Composer tự CodeCanyon. Tính đến thời điểm viết bài mức chi phí cho một giấy phép mở rộng là $170.

*
*
*
Giấy phép không ngừng mở rộng của Visual Composer trường đoản cú CodeCanyon

Một "giấy phép mở rộng" là gì?

Giấy phép mở rộng cho phép sử dụng plugin, bởi bạn hoặc một khách hàng, trong một sản phẩm đơn mà những người dùng hoàn toàn có thể trả phí. Đơn giá bao gồm giá thành phầm và phí tín đồ mua.

Về cơ bản, bạn đặt hàng một giấy tờ cho nhà phát triển để áp dụng Visual Composer cùng với một trong những theme của bạn. Quý khách mua theme đó không bắt buộc phải mua giấy phép thường thì của Visual Composer.

Nó bao gồm những gì?

Bạn ko thể áp dụng giấy phép mở rộng cho nhiều theme, hoặc không thể chia sẻ giấy phép mở rộng của công ty với một ai khác. Chúng ta không được chia sẻ khoá thừa nhận dạng giấy phép với các quý khách của bạn, và quý khách của các bạn sẽ không cần phải kích hoạt Visual Composer (bản sao kèm theo với theme của bạn).

Những update của Visual Composer là gì?

Một vào những thắc mắc thông dụng duy nhất mà shop chúng tôi nhận được trên Ninzio Themes là "Tôi ko thể update Visual Composer". Điều này không thể tiến hành từ mặt khách hàng; mỗi cập nhật của Visual Composer phải được đánh giá và cung ứng các bạn dạng cập nhật của theme.

Xem thêm: Cách Dùng Kit Test Newgene Covid, Newgene Covid

"Giấy phép In-Stock"

Nhưng chờ chút đang — WPBakery nói rằng "không còn có thể sử dụng các thành phầm từ thị trường bên trong các sản phẩm của công ty mà dự tính bán bên trên Envato được nữa". Vậy làm vắt nào chúng ta cũng có thể thêm Visual Composer vào vào theme của khách hàng để được phân phối trên ThemeForest nếu bản thảo mở rộng của chúng ta không có thể chấp nhận được làm điều đó? Đây là khu vực mà một "giao kèo" đặc trưng giữa các bạn và Michael M (tác mang của plugin Visual Composer) đẩy mạnh tác dụng: giấy phép In-Stock".

Một khi bạn đã tải giấy phép mở rộng từ CodeCanyon, hãy vào trang cung cấp WPBakery và đăng nhập với thông tin tài khoản đăng nhập Envato của bạn.

*
*
*
Màn hình đăng nhập WPBakery

Một thông tin hiện lên với cái chữ Authorize WPBakery support Portal khổng lồ connect with your account?; Nhấp vào Approve. Tiếp theo, nếu như khách hàng đã mua giấy phép mở rộng, WPBakery tự động hóa hiển thị bản thảo đã mua vừa mới đây trong bảng điều khiển, chính vì vậy hãy chọn giấy phép, nhập tên theme cùng nhấn Submit. Giấy phép mở rộng của bạn sẽ trở thành "Giấy phép In-Stock". ThemeForest biết, WPBakery biết, chúng ta biết đầy đủ thứ là được phép, vày vậy chúng ta có thể thêm Visual Composer ngơi nghỉ trong theme của doanh nghiệp và bán chúng ơ trên ThemeForest.

Tại thời khắc này, bọn họ đã trả tất câu hỏi xem xét các yếu tố pháp lý của bài toán tích vừa lòng Visual Composer, bây giờ là lúc đánh giá về phương diện kỹ thuật.

Tích vừa lòng vào theme: giải đáp Kỹ thuật

Không có vô số thứ tương quan đến câu hỏi tích hợp Visual Composer với theme của bạn. Công ty chúng tôi sẽ lý giải quá trình sử dụng một trong các theme của bọn chúng tôi, ga-analytics#sendMarketClickEvent">Focuson, như là một trong ví dụ.

*
*
*
ga-analytics#sendMarketClickEvent">Focuson

Tạo môi trường xung quanh cần thiết

Chúng ta cần một vài thứ sau:

Một tập tin php để tích phù hợp với Visual Composer. Tập tin này chứa những tuỳ chọn thành phần tuỳ phát triển thành của bạn, hiển thị trong trình đối kháng bảng điều khiển và tinh chỉnh của Visual Composer. Trong trường thích hợp của bọn họ điều này được call là "ninzio_vc.php" và được để trong thư mục theme > includes. Một folder template Visual Composer đang chứa những tập tin php của các phần tử mặc định trong Visual Composer, trong trường hợp chúng ta cần thay thế sửa chữa chúng. Thư mục phải được lấy tên là "vc_templates", và toàn bộ các tập tin được đặt bên trong thư mục kia nên được đặt tên một cách đúng mực giống như các cái ở trong thư mục "vc_tempaltes" của Visual Composer. Trong trường phù hợp của cửa hàng chúng tôi chúng tôi tất cả bốn tập tin cơ mà được mở rộng với kết cấu và bản lĩnh tuỳ biến: "vc_column.php", "vc_column_text.php", "vc_row.php", với "vc_video.php". Thư mục "vc_templates" nên được sắp xếp trực tiếp bên phía trong thư mục gốc của theme các bạn thư mục theme > vc_templates.

Cuối cùng nhưng không kém quan trọng, bởi vì Visual Composer là 1 trong plugin mở rộng, bọn họ cần thêm nó với gói theme hoàn toàn có thể tải về. Ở đây shop chúng tôi có nhì tuỳ chọn:

Bao có tập tin "js_composer.zip" bên phía trong gói sở hữu về cùng yêu cầu khách hàng thiết đặt nó bằng tay.

Chúng tôi thấy tuỳ chọn thứ nhị là cách rất tốt để yêu ước và đề xuất các plugin mang lại theme WordPress. Để làm vấn đề này hãy sinh sản một folder "plugins" bên phía trong thư mục gốc của theme các bạn và để tập tin "js_composer.zip" (tập tin thiết lập của Visual Composer mà bạn đã sở hữu về sau khoản thời gian mua) vào đó. Để tham khảo thêm về TGM Plugin Activator hãy coi qua bài xích hướng dẫn thực hiện thư viện TGM Plugin Activator trong những theme của công ty bởi Barış Ünver.

WordPress Theme Check

WordPress Theme Check không thích thú khi một theme dĩ nhiên một plugin. Nó sẽ đưa ra chú ý thế này:

REQUIRED: Zip file found. Plugins are not allowed in themes. The zip tệp tin found was js_composer.zip

Không may, đối với vấn đề này không tồn tại hướng dẫn chủ yếu thức. Vị kèm theo một folder plugin vào theme của bạn đi ngược lại với giấy phép Plugin trong Theme của Envato - vấn đề kiểm tra Theme, không có cách nào tốt hơn để kèm plugin với theme.

Hãy thả lỏng thôi

Vậy, hiện nay chúng ta có...

...tập tin js_composer.zip được kèm bên phía trong theme (fucoson > plugins > js_composer.zip) ...tạo các thành phần php tuỳ trở thành (ninzio-addons > shortcodes > shortcodes.php). Yêu cầu nhớ rằng họ có plugin ninzio-addons với toàn bộ các khả năng tuỳ trở thành trong nó, và nó kèm theo với theme. ...tạo tập tin tích hòa hợp Visual Composer (focuson > includes > ninzio_vc.php) ...và chế tác thư mục "vc_templates" đựng các thành phần Visual Composer khoác định cho việc mở rộng với kĩ năng tuỳ biến.

Bao gồm các thành phần theo yêu cầu

Bây giờ hãy trả tất bài toán tích hợp bằng cách bao gồm các thành phần theo yêu thương cầu. Mở tập tin "functions.php" và với TGM Plugin Activator, thêm Visual Composer vào danh sách các plugin được yêu thương cầu: